Latest Patents

Antoine holds a patent for a fluid sensor that utilizes a tuning fork mechanical resonator. This innovative sensor includes a base and a tine that projects from the base along the tine's longitudinal direction. The design incorporates a pair of electrodes that are strategically placed on the tine, which is made from a piezoelectric material known as lithium tantalate. The electrodes are exposed to the fluid, allowing for precise measurements of fluid properties.
